I am having trouble with the attachments that are coming
into Outlook Express. Somehow they are all being denied
saying "OE removed access to the following unsafe
attachments in your mail: file name of file.
Thanks for your help. I am running Windows XP home
edition. I didn't change any of the settings in Outlook
Express but I do get the Automatic Updates from
Microsoft. Thanks for any help you can be. Frank
 
Frank;
Outlook Express:
Open Outlook Express.
Click Tools, click Options, click Security tab.
Uncheck "Do not allow attachments..."

This change that Microsoft implemented is to help prevent viruses and
other bad code being received with attachments.
It is ALWAYS a bad to open an unexpected attachment.
Verify the sender sent the attachment before opening.

Microsoft NEVER sends Email with attachments.
